Yet another leak in the Windows 8 arena. Yesterday Windows 8 Milestone 7955 has been leaked. Compared to the recent leak of 7850 which showcased very little new features, this new build has many new features we have been seeing in leaked screenshots, such as modern task manager, Internet Explorer's Immersive UI and Modern PDF reader are built in it.

Have you download the Windows 8 7955 on your computer?